DigitalMedia™ Room Controller & DM CAT Receiver
The DM-RMC-100 provides a convenient one-box interface solution to support
a single display device as part of a complete DigitalMedia system. It
functions as a DM CAT receiver and control interface, providing a single
HDMI output along with a variety of control ports. Its compact,
low-profile design allows the DM-RMC-100 to be installed discreetly behind
a flat panel display or above a ceiling mounted projector.

DigitalMedia distributes uncompressed digital video and audio signals up
to 450 feet (137 m) using DM cable, or shorter distances using standard
CAT5e/6*. DigitalMedia thoughtfully manages all of the different signals
and devices, matching each source's output to the capabilities of the
selected display(s) without using scaling or compression. Every signal is
preserved in its native video resolution and audio format, ensuring a
pure, lossless signal path throughout.

A single HDMI digital AV output port is provided on the DM-RMC-100,
supporting HDMI 1.3a w/Deep Color and HDCP, handling WUXGA computer
resolutions and 1080p60 HDTV with multi-channel HD lossless audio—all
through a single connection. The HDMI output can also handle DVI signals
using an appropriate adapter or interface cable†. In addition,
there are RS-232, IR, and Ethernet control ports provided for controlling
the display device, plus two relays for screen and lift control, and a
SENS input for connection of an optional current sensor or contact
closure.
Multiple DM-RMC-100s may be installed to handle each display in a
multi-room distribution system, all fed from a central DM-MD series
switcher. Or, a single DM-RMC-100 can be fed straight from a DM-TX-100DM-TX-100DM-TX-100DM-TX-100
or other DM CAT transmitter to provide a simple solution for extending a
computer or AV signal to feed a single display. The connection to the
switcher or transmitter requires just one DigitalMedia cable, with a
potential cable length up to 450 feet*. In lieu of a central switcher, the
DM-RMC-100's LAN port may be used to connect over Ethernet to a 2-Series
control system if needed.

When connected to a DM-MD series switcher or DM-TX-100DM-TX-100DM-TX-100DM-TX-100 transmitter, the
DM-RMC-100 functions as a keyboard/mouse extender, allowing a USB
HID-compliant keyboard and/or mouse to be connected at the display
location, and used to control a computer or other host device located at
the central equipment rack or some other remote location.

The primary objective of every Crestron system is to enable precisely the
control desired for a seamless user experience. The DM-RMC-100 includes
built-in RS-232, IR, and Ethernet control ports to allow programmable
control of the display device connected to it. But, it can also provide an
alternative to these conventional control methods by harnessing the CEC
(Consumer Electronics Control) signal embedded in HDMI. Through its
connection to the control system, the DM-RMC-100 provides a gateway for
controlling the display device right through the HDMI connection,
potentially eliminating the need for any dedicated control wires or IR
probes.

The DM-RMC-100 mounts to a standard 2-gang, 4" square, or UK electrical
box, and sticks out only one inch from the wall surface. Connections to
the display are all positioned along the bottom edge of the receiver,
allowing cables to be dressed neatly without obstruction. The DM and LAN
connection are made behind the unit within the electrical box. An array of
indicators on the front of the DM-RMC-100 provide for easy setup and
troubleshooting, verifying the status of connections and signal activity
at a glance.
